Heralds of the Rain

In Tifira, found in all cities and settlements, is a group called the monsoon watchers. Some refer to them as the heralds of the rain because of their near fanatical interest in the rain. Monsoons can bear heavy consequences if underestimated, and the monsoon watchers take it upon themselves to ensure that cities and citizens are prepared for the rain. They carefully track weather patterns and have been able to predict many meteorological events with some accuracy.   In addition to these everyday functions, monsoon watchers believe that the Great Rain is coming. An event of unfathomable magnitude, the Great Rain is believed to be a monsoon of such strength that it could change the shape of the Tifira desert forever. The monsoon watchers say that such an event has happened in the past, but predates historical records. The lack of concrete proof of this great rain has led many to take their predictions with a grain of sand.   Every major settlement in Tifira has an office where the monsoon watchers reside. Here, they keep up with local weather, providing advice and predictions to citizens. Messages are often passed between offices and settlements to compare and compile data from around the regions. Exactly what the monsoon watchers do with this information is a mystery to most, and one that few care to solve. However, the organization holds none of this as secret, and will gladly share their information and what it means to anyone who cares to learn.   Though their behavior borders on worship, the monsoon watchers do not consider their interesting and respect for the power of the rains to be a religion. In fact, most of them are devout believers in Hilim, believing that the coming rains are His will. They consider their actions to be in strictly tied to their worship of Hilim, an act of faith that He has called them to perform.   Some believe the Great Rain to be an ultimate test of faith. The rain will cause a flood of the desert, cleansing the land of impure spirits. Those who have proved themselves to Hilim with their deeds and worth of heart will be spared, and they will be the ones to rebuild Tifiran society in this new fertile land. This theory is based only on scripture, not science or gathered data. While some monsoon watchers hold this belief personally, it is not a main tenet of their organization.
